3 NFL Players Who Could Be Involved In Trades In 2021

By Jake Luppino February 19, 2021 @jakeluppino

NFL logo on floor

 

With the new NFL calendar year approaching, fans can start expecting more trade rumors.

In fact, things already got kicked started as Carson Wentz was traded to the Indianapolis Colts.

Also, Matthew Stafford was traded to the Los Angeles Rams in late January.

Two of the many dominos to fall.

Here are three other players that can expect to be involved in a trade for this upcoming season.

 

1. QB Deshaun Watson

Perhaps, this is the most obvious one.

Over the last couple months, Deshaun Watson has made it obvious that he wants out of Houston.

With much dysfunction in Houston, Watson feels his best chance of winning is elsewhere and quite frankly, he is right.

While the Texans have been adamant about retaining their franchise quarterback, sources around the league believe it is only a matter of time before Watson is traded.

The New York Jets and Miami Dolphins appear to be the frontrunners to land Watson as they have the most draft capital to give up.

With the recent release of J.J. Watt and the eventual trade of Watson, the Texans are clearly in rebuild mode and need to acquire as much draft capital as possible moving forward.

The San Francisco 49ers are also contenders for Watson.

This storyline will continue to play out throughout the next couple of weeks.

But, it is more likely than not, that Watson is playing with a new team in 2021.

 

2. WR Odell Beckham Jr

This one may come as a surprise too many — but, quite honestly, it shouldn’t.

Last year, the Browns were able to snap a near two decade playoff streak, and they did it without their star WR, Odell Beckham Jr.

In fact, many anticipated the Browns offense to be more efficient after Odell Beckham Jr. suffered a season ending injury.

QB Baker Mayfield would find himself forcing the ball to Odell too often.

In his absence, the Browns established a balanced attack, running the ball well and building off of that with the play action game.

The timing of all of this is not coincidental.

As of late, recent trade rumors have surfaced surrounding the star wideout.

Certain sources believe it is only a matter of time before Odell gets traded.

The four potential teams interested in Odell are the Packers, Ravens, 49ers and Football Team.

 

3. CB Stephon Gilmore

New England Patriots CB Stephon Gilmore could be on the move this offseason.

Last year — before the trade deadline — New England shopped the cornerback and had no buyers.

Coming off a season ending injury, Gilmore could certainly have an impact on a team.

It was just a short while ago that Gilmore was named 2019 Defensive Player of the Year.

With an expensive contract, Gilmore would have to go to a team who could afford him.

The most ideal situation for the star cornerback would be a contending team.

Teams such as the Cleveland Browns and New York Giants are rumored to be interested in Gilmore, if he becomes available.

Both of those teams could use some help in the backend and certainly have some draft capital that would get the deal done.
